This is an absolutely beautiful green space near the med center and museums. Its a great place to sit and enjoy whatever good weather Houston gets. Parking is much better than it used to be, but its still gets full so metered parking on the road is usually necessary on weekends, holidays, or during park events. There is no super close food (Bodegas is a blockish away) so pack a picnic and maybe bully your favorite food truck into making routine stops.

Review №82

Lovely well maintained gardens laid out along a central man made lagoon with some interesting attractions. At one end is spiral walkway up to a viewpoint on a little man made hill, with a beautiful cascading waterfall down the side. Take a photo at the bottom of the waterfall.At the other end is a plaza with outdoor tables and probably a restaurant or concession, I am not certain. There are hidden side excursions, to a rose garden, to a herb garden, to a vegetable garden, so it is fun to discover and explore. Great for families with active kids. Stroller friendly with wide sidewalks. Located just across from the Museum of Natural Science.
